Title: Innovations by Jörg Malken: Advancements in Process Engineering
Introduction: Jörg Malken, an accomplished inventor based in Minden, Germany, has made significant contributions to the field of process engineering. With a total of two patents to his name, Malken focuses on enhancing the efficiency and control of process engineering systems. Latest Patents: Malken's latest patents include a crucial development in the form of a module for a process engineering system and a method for controlling such systems. This invention features process engineering hardware designed for executing specific sub-processes, alongside a sophisticated control system. The control system operates independently, allowing for the hardware to be adjusted to various predefined states. Furthermore, it includes an external interface capable of receiving commands that correspond with these states, showcasing Malken's ability to integrate advanced control mechanisms in process engineering.
Career Highlights: Throughout his career, Jörg Malken has been associated with Wago Verwaltungsgesellschaft MbH, a company recognized for its dedication to automation and process control solutions.
